-Subject: [PATCH] ifupdown: pass interface device name for ipv6 route commands
-MIME-Version: 1.0
-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8
-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it
-
-commit 028524317d8d0011ed38e86e507a06738a5b5a97 from upstream
-
-IPv6 routes need the device argument for link-local routes, or they
-cannot be used at all. E.g. "gateway fe80::def" seems to be used in
-some places, but kernel refuses to insert the route unless device
-name is explicitly specified in the route addition.

-diff --git a/networking/ifupdown.c b/networking/ifupdown.c
-index 17bc4e9..a00f68d 100644
---- a/networking/ifupdown.c
-+++ b/networking/ifupdown.c
-@@ -394,8 +394,8 @@ static int FAST_FUNC static_up6(struct interface_defn_t *ifd, execfn *exec)
- # if ENABLE_FEATURE_IFUPDOWN_IP
- result = execute("ip addr add %address%/%netmask% dev %iface%[[ label %label%]]", ifd, exec);
- result += execute("ip link set[[ mtu %mtu%]][[ addr %hwaddress%]] %iface% up", ifd, exec);
-- /* Was: "[[ ip ....%gateway% ]]". Removed extra spaces w/o checking */
-- result += execute("[[ip route add ::/0 via %gateway%]][[ metric %metric%]]", ifd, exec);
-+ /* Reportedly, IPv6 needs "dev %iface%", but IPv4 does not: */
-+ result += execute("[[ip route add ::/0 via %gateway% dev %iface%]][[ metric %metric%]]", ifd, exec);
- # else
- result = execute("ifconfig %iface%[[ media %media%]][[ hw %hwaddress%]][[ mtu %mtu%]] up", ifd, exec);
- result += execute("ifconfig %iface% add %address%/%netmask%", ifd, exec);
-@@ -421,7 +421,8 @@ static int FAST_FUNC v4tunnel_up(struct interface_defn_t *ifd, execfn *exec)
- "%endpoint%[[ local %local%]][[ ttl %ttl%]]", ifd, exec);
- result += execute("ip link set %iface% up", ifd, exec);
- result += execute("ip addr add %address%/%netmask% dev %iface%", ifd, exec);
-- result += execute("[[ip route add ::/0 via %gateway%]]", ifd, exec);
-+ /* Reportedly, IPv6 needs "dev %iface%", but IPv4 does not: */
-+ result += execute("[[ip route add ::/0 via %gateway% dev %iface%]]", ifd, exec);
- return ((result == 4) ? 4 : 0);
- }
